1. Product Overview
The VEMER VE792000 TMS 24/36 is a compact, stabilized switching power supply designed for DIN rail installation. It provides a stable 24 Vdc output with a power rating of 36 W, suitable for various civil, industrial, and commercial applications requiring a stabilized DC voltage. This power supply features robust protection against thermal overload, overcurrent, and short circuits, ensuring safe operation for both users and connected equipment. A blue LED indicator provides visual confirmation of the operational status.

Figure 1: VEMER VE792000 TMS 24/36 Stabilized Switching Power Supply.
Key Features:
- 24 Vdc stabilized output.
- 36 W power rating.
- DIN rail installation (4 modules).
- Wide input voltage range: 110-350V DC; 115-230V AC - 50/60Hz.
- Integrated thermal, overload, and short-circuit protection.
- Blue LED for operational status indication.
- Compact dimensions.

3. Setup and Installation
The VEMER VE792000 TMS 24/36 is designed for easy installation on a standard DIN rail.
3.1 Mounting
- Ensure the power to the DIN rail circuit is disconnected.
- Hook the top edge of the power supply onto the DIN rail.
- Press the bottom edge firmly until it clicks into place.
- Verify that the unit is securely fastened to the DIN rail.
3.2 Wiring Connections
Refer to the wiring diagram on the device and below for correct connections. Use appropriate wire gauges for the input and output currents.

Figure 2: Example wiring diagram for VEMER TMS series power supplies. Consult the specific diagram on your device for exact terminal assignments.
- Input Power: Connect the AC (115-230V AC, 50/60Hz) or DC (110-350V DC) input to the designated input terminals. Ensure correct polarity for DC input.
- Output Power: Connect your 24 Vdc load to the output terminals. Observe correct polarity (+ and -).
- Grounding: Ensure proper grounding according to local electrical codes.

6. Troubleshooting
If you encounter issues with your VEMER VE792000 TMS 24/36 power supply, refer to the following troubleshooting guide:
| Problem | Possible Cause | Solution |
|---|---|---|
| No blue LED indicator, no output voltage. | No input power, incorrect wiring, internal fault. | Check input power supply and connections. Verify wiring against the diagram. If problem persists, the unit may be faulty. |
| Blue LED is on, but no output voltage or incorrect voltage. | Output wiring fault, short circuit on output, overload condition. | Check output wiring for loose connections or short circuits. Disconnect load to check if output voltage returns. Reduce load if overloaded. |
| Unit repeatedly shuts down or cycles. | Overload, short circuit, or overheating. | Check for overload or short circuit on the output. Ensure adequate ventilation and ambient temperature. |
If troubleshooting steps do not resolve the issue, contact VEMER technical support. Do not attempt to repair the unit yourself.
7. Specifications
| Parameter | Value |
|---|---|
| Model Number | VE792000 |
| Brand | VEMER |
| Input Voltage | 110-350V DC; 115-230V AC - 50/60Hz |
| Output Voltage | 24 Vdc |
| Power Output | 36 W |
| Installation Type | DIN Rail (4 modules) |
| Protection Features | Thermal, Overload, Short-circuit |
| Indicator | Blue LED (Operational Status) |
| Dimensions (Package) | 10.9 x 8.5 x 7.9 cm |
| Weight (Package) | 300 grams |
| Certifications | CE |
| Country of Origin | Italy |
